Managing Workspaces with Android App
Workspaces are the core of Secrata — this is where you store files, invite collaborators, and communicate with your team.
Secrata offers two workspace types:
- Shared Workspaces – Can be shared with other users.
- Private Workspaces – Cannot ever be shared; intended for private files only.
When you open the app, you'll be asked which workspace type you'd like to manage. Your workspaces are listed alphabetically in a scrollable list.
Accepting or declining invitations
If you've been invited to a new workspace, the invitation will appear in your workspace list.
- Tap the invitation.
- Choose Accept or Decline.
Creating a workspace
- Tap the + icon in the upper-right corner.
- Enter a workspace name and an optional description.
- Choose Shared or Private.
- Tap Create Workspace. You'll be taken directly into the new workspace.
Note: You can invite people to a shared workspace later, from within the workspace itself.
Leaving a workspace
Leaving a workspace removes all your access to its files and messages. Remaining members can invite you back if needed, and once the last member leaves, the workspace is permanently deleted.
- Go to the Workspaces view, long-press the workspace you want to leave, then tap Leave to confirm.
